[ 01 ] // WHAT IS RAP LIEGEOIS

Rap Liegeois is a hip-hop subgenre originating in Liège, Belgium, in the early 1990s. It is characterized by boom-bap beats, sampled loops, and French-language lyrics focusing on local street life and social issues.

Rap Liegeois is defined by hard-hitting boom-bap drums, often with a slightly laid-back swing. The beats typically feature sampled loops from jazz, funk, and soul records, layered with deep basslines and occasional scratches. Vocals are delivered with a clear, rhythmic flow, often in French or the local Walloon dialect.

The production emphasizes gritty, lo-fi textures, avoiding polished pop sounds. The tempo ranges from 88 to 120 BPM, with a focus on head-nodding grooves. Lyrical content is narrative-driven, painting vivid pictures of street life and social commentary.

[ 05 ] // HISTORY & ORIGIN

History & Origins
of Rap Liegeois

Rap Liegeois emerged in the early 1990s in Liège, Belgium, as a localized response to American hip-hop. Influenced by French rap and the golden age of East Coast hip-hop, Liège artists began crafting their own sound using drum machines and samplers.

Throughout the 1990s and 2000s, the genre evolved, incorporating elements of jazz, funk, and soul samples. The lyrics often reflect the realities of post-industrial Liège, addressing unemployment, immigration, and urban decay.

Culturally, Rap Liegeois serves as a voice for the city's marginalized communities. It maintains a strong local identity while contributing to the broader Francophone hip-hop scene, with artists often performing in the local dialect or standard French.

[ 06 ] // FOR PRODUCERS

How to Make
Rap Liegeois

How Rap Liegeois is built — drum pattern, swing, and the sounds you need.

For producers aiming to create Rap Liegeois, start with a drum machine like the MPC or SP-1200. Use a classic boom-bap pattern: kick on 1 and 3, snare on 2 and 4, with hi-hats on eighth notes. Add slight swing (around 55-60%) for a human feel.

Sample from obscure jazz, funk, or soul records; loop a short section and layer with a bassline. Keep the mix gritty—use low-pass filters and vinyl crackle. The BPM should sit between 88 and 100 for a laid-back vibe, or up to 120 for more energetic tracks. Focus on simplicity and repetition.
